GAVIN QUITS AS CANDIDATE JUST HOURS AFTER LIVE TV DEBATE

JIM Gavin told a TV debate he was looking into reports he owes a former tenant €3,000 just hours before he dropped out of the presidential race last night.

It relates to a dispute with a former tenant around the time his own family came into financial difficulty.

The Fianna Fail candidate added: “That matter was over 16 years ago. It was a very stressful time for myself and my family. Like a lot of families and couples, we came into financial difficulty at that time.”

URGENCY

Mr Gavin said: “If it happened, I'm very sorry it happened. I'm looking into it and will deal with it with urgency.”

The former manager of the Dublin football team also questioned if the “time is right” for a poll on Irish unity.

Mr Gavin made the comments during the second live TV presidential debate with Independent TD Catherine Connolly and Fine Gael candidate Heather Humphreys on RTE’s The Week in Politics.

He said: “I'm not sure if the time is right. We've a lot of work to do with the North of Ireland.” Ms Connolly said, if elected, she would like to see a referendum during her tenure.

She added: “It has to be done by consent, with respect for all communities and all traditions.”
